Translated (all J.Wong's words):
- the pictures i trimmed the sides a bit, coz it was too large. overall, the quality is pretty good, isnt it?
- software for m8 is not yet finalized so no news on that
- we decided that m8 8gb 256mb RRP 2580 yuan, and they said they only make 240yuan or sonething... after the tax etc. (what the)
- we gave up the 128mb version, all releases will be 256mb
- final prices are not made by the financial team, it is made by me. they are just some additional sources that i can look onto.
- my strategy is: sell at acceptable price -> match or beat the mainstream prices -> maintain a long time of no price-increase.
- replace small commission with mass sales, replace mass sales with product make up, replace time with space
- understand? (i sort of do... lol)
- the picture quality isnt the greatest here, as i (j.wong) was not using the newest firmware version (hence the sideways picture orientation, as he explains).
- the sound quality is good too, new earphones way better then PT850
- the overall look and feel is better then any phone i've played with (namely nokia and their n73)
